E Lu located at No.12 Castle Peak Road(Lam Tei). It consist of 4 towers.It provides 64 units in total.

For Sale and Lease

Save Item

Information

Total Block:
4 Towers
Permit:
1987 Yr.
Total Unit:
64 Units

Map

E Lu Map